Footballers ramp up security and install panic rooms after Dele Alli ordeal

Reading now: 658
www.dailystar.co.uk

Footballers are ramping up security and installing panic rooms in their homes in the wake of Dele Alli’s terrifying robbery ordeal.

The England star was beaten by masked raiders wielding knives – and it has spooked his fellow professionals, experts have revealed.

Worried stars are now looking at secure rooms, as well as house guards, attack dogs, extra CCTV and motion detectors to deter burglary gangs.

Reshma Sheikh, boss of Octavian Security, said: “Many footballers and celebrities are naturally concerned following this incident. “There has been a spike in football players looking for private security solutions.
